The last supported version for node 4 is `1.143.6`
You can install it by doing `npm i -g snyk@1.143.6`
On 30th of April, 2018, Node.js 4 was officially marked as End of Life (EOL) and ceased to receive security updates.
We highly recommend that you follow a migration path to a stable and officially supported version of Node.js to be able to receive bug and security fixes. You’ll want to upgrade your version to at least Node.js 10 Dubnium (although we recommend 12 Erbium, the latest LTS)
